Why Is Minna no Nihongo Lesson 1 So Important?

Lesson 1 is more than just a list of words; it’s your gateway to conversational Japanese. You learn how to introduce yourself, ask and answer basic questions about identity and nationality, and recognize common professions.

Here are some examples you’ll master:

  • わたしはマイクさんです。 (I am Mike.)

  • あのひとはだれですか? (Who is that person?)

  • わたしはがくせいではありません。 (I am not a student.)

These fundamental sentence structures and vocabulary form the bedrock for everything that follows. Without a strong grasp of these basics, it becomes difficult to progress to more complex lessons.

Tips for Effective Practice

✅ Consistency is Key: Practice 15–20 minutes daily.
✅ Active Recall: Try to answer before flipping the card.
✅ Use All Modes: Flashcards → Quiz → Study Guide.
✅ Practice Out Loud: Improve speaking & accent naturally.
